What They're Looking For.
Must Have
A minimum of 4 years of experience in medical devices, engineering, or failure analysis., Troubleshooting mind set - an ability to methodically break down a system or process into subparts to identify failures and troubleshoot to a component level., Knowledge of 8D problem solving, Fishbone Diagraming, and the Five Whys., Proven ability to work in teams and to work cross-functionally., interpersonal and communication skills., Able to assist people in finding creative solutions around constraints., analytic skills as proven by track record for analyzing complex problems, technical report writing skills, Must be proficient in the use of Microsoft Office suite of applications., Able to verify assembly documentation accuracy and to read engineering drawings, Understanding of product risks and experience identifying improvements to FMEA and risk management documentation
Nice to Have
Knowledge of Good Manufacturing Practices & Quality Systems Regulations is a plus., Familiarity with SAP and Tableau is a plus., Familiarity with SQL and Snowflake is a plus., Knowledge of basic statistical analysis methods is desirable., Understanding of various advanced failure analysis tools/methodologies (ex: FTIR, SEM-EDS, fractography) is desirable.
